FIFA Slams Egyptian Club With Transfer Ban Over Super Eagles Striker's Debt

By Tunde Shamsudeen

Nogoom FC have been banned from signing players due to an outstanding $5, 000 debt they owe Super Eagles and Plateau United striker, Tosin Abraham Omoyele.

According to buwanews.com the Egyptian football club currently plays in the Egyptian Second Division, and have been handed a three-window transfer ban by World football governing body, according to a statement from Erika Montemor Ferreira, FIFA Head of Players Status, revealed on Wednesday June 10, 2020.

“According to the decision passed by Dispute Resolution Chamber (DRC) judge on 17 January, 2020, Nogoom was asked to provide us with documentary evidence demonstrating that it had compiled with its obligation in accordance with point III.2 of the aforementioned decision.

“In this respect, we have noted that no such documentation has been submitted by Nogoom and consequently, we kindly inform the club, Nogoom, that the ban from registering any new players either nationally or internationally, for the maximum duration of three entire and consecutive registration periods, as established in point III.7, of the above mentioned will become effective as from the start of the next registration period.

“Finally, we would like to draw Nogoom to point III.8 of the relevant decision which establishes that the aforementioned ban will be lifted immediately and prior to its complete serving, once the due amount is paid,” the State concluded.

Omoyele, played on loan to Nogoom last season from Plateau United and the club’s ban will be lifted once the debt totaling $5, 000 is either paid off or restructured.
